Problem
Conventional seat pads for turkey hunters lack the ability to effectively reposition and enhance the line of sight while maintaining comfort, as they are often fixed and do not accommodate the need for adjusting distance from objects like trees or varying ground levels.
Innovation Solution
A seating apparatus that combines sliding and pivoting capabilities, with adjustable and collapsible legs, and can be integrated into a vest or backpack for easy transport, allowing hunters to reposition and improve their vantage point by sliding horizontally and pivoting 360 degrees around a tree or other object.

A seating apparatus that is capable of both sliding and pivoting thereby lending to advantageously positioning a hunter in relation to their prey. By enabling a seat portion to horizontally slide along a plane, the hunter can reposition away from an object, e.g., a tree. Additionally, the seat portion of the apparatus is capable of pivoting in either direction thereby enhancing line of sight to hunting game.
